Onboarding 5,000 SKUs is what makes or breaks a POS rollout. HelloBooks ships per-industry CSV templates that already encode the right columns (style/colour/size for apparel, batch/expiry for pharmacy, weight/purity for jewellery), and a chunked importer that previews before committing.

Per-industry templates
A pharmacy upload needs batch and expiry; a jewellery upload needs purity and weight; an apparel upload needs colour, size, and style. We ship the right template per industry — no “figure out the columns yourself”.
- Apparel / footwear (style × colour × size)
- Pharmacy (batch / expiry / Schedule)
- Jewellery (purity / weight / hallmark)
- Restaurant / mandi / grocery
Diff preview before commit
After upload, the importer shows what is new, what changes, and what looks suspicious (negative stock, missing HSN, duplicate SKU). Fix the spreadsheet, re-upload, repeat.
- New / change / warning view
- Cell-level diff
- Validation per row
- Cancel without commit
Chunked import
Upload 50,000 SKUs in one file; we import in 500-row chunks with progress. If row 12,734 fails, the rest still goes through and the failure ends up in a downloadable report.
- 500-row chunks
- Resumable on failure
- Failure report download
- Background processing

Questions, answered
Can I edit the template?
Yes — the template is a CSV. Add columns we recognise (custom fields) or skip optional ones; the importer respects your shape.
What happens if a row fails?
It is captured in a failure report (CSV download). The rest of the chunk imports successfully. Fix the failed rows and re-upload.
Can I re-upload to update?
Yes. The importer matches by SKU; existing rows are updated, new rows are created. No duplicates.
How big can the file be?
We test up to 100,000 rows. Larger uploads work but split into multiple files for safety.
